×
sites large-scale
meaning in Chinese
大型的场地
Related Words
site
sites
siting
site site
large
larger
largest
large scale site
sites d’entranement
sites in pagan
sites of customs inspection
sites of predilection
PC Version
Copyright © 2018 WordTech Co.